Polygenetic Inheritance
A form of inheritance where traits are governed by more than one gene, leading to a continuous range of possible phenotypes.
Phenotypic Expression
The observable physical or biochemical characteristics of an organism, as determined by both genetic makeup and environmental influences.
Genetic Drift
A mechanism of evolution that involves random changes in the frequency of alleles within a population over time.
Body Build
The physical composition of an individual, including their muscle, bone, and fat distribution, which can influence their physical capabilities and appearance.
